What companies run services between Bingen (Rhein) Hbf, Germany and Heidelberg, Germany?

Deutsche Bahn Intercity (DB IC) operates a train from Bingen, Hauptbahnhof to Heidelberg, Hauptbahnhof once daily. Tickets cost €32–36 and the journey takes 1h 12m.
